Another question.

 

Is the Ganso Bomb/Hangman's DDT a legit move? I've seen a/the clip- and there just doesn't seem to be a safe way to take it.

 

I thought I'd read that it was a botched move, if so- what was the move that was being attempted?

Posted

As I recall, the Ganso Bomb as we know it (ie, the one used in the Misawa-Kawada match) was supposed to be a standard power bomb, but due to an injury earlier in the match the person taking the move was unable to pull himself back up the parallel-to-the-mat position and mouthed to his opponent to just drop him.

 

As I recall, Lou Thesz also used a move called the Ganso Bomb (which is where the second one got its name - Thesz's was the original [ganso] power bomb). It was a throwing piledriver, which is obviously not something you'd want to do very often. Basically, he'd hold the opponent upside down as if for a piledriver and just spike him downward.

Posted

The move from the Misawa Kawada match was Planned. Kawada had told Misawa at some point he was doing it.

 

It was a one off spot, and was NEVER called the Ganso bomb, it was called by it's technical name:

 

Jumping Kneeling Vertical Sheer Drop Powerbomb.

 

Thesz's Ganso Bomb was the Original Powerbomb (Ganso meaning Original) It's as Ace309 described, a Throwing Piledriver.

 

As for the Misawa Kawada spot, you'll notice Misawa's head isnt that far off the group, and he uses his arms to take some of the impact. Still nasty, but not that brutal.

 

It also didn not end the match. Not even close.

need help

please describe:

 

Chris Chetti's "Amittyville Horror"

 

Colt Cobanna's"Colt 45"

 

checkenwing pilerdriver

 

JImmy Rave's "From Dusk til Dawn"

 

Chris Hamrick's"Confederate Crunch"

 

Christian York's"Onion Buster"

 

Frank Z's "Wave of the Future,

Flux Capacitator"

Guest Real F'n Show
Posted

Chris Chetti's "Amittyville Horror"

 

Fireman's carry into sit out slam (samoan driver in SD games)

 

Colt Cobanna's"Colt 45"

 

double underhook sit out over the shoulder backbreaker (think albert's trainwreck with the arms hooked and a sit out)

 

checkenwing pilerdriver

 

double underhook piledriver

 

JImmy Rave's "From Dusk til Dawn"

 

satellite headscissors into crippler crossface

 

Chris Hamrick's"Confederate Crunch"

 

top rope legdrop

 

Christian York's"Onion Buster"

 

never heard of it. sorry

 

Frank Z's "Wave of the Future,

 

swinging downward spiral sorta with more impact

 

Flux Capacitator"

 

top rope backflip while standing next to opponent and landing with opponent beign rock bottomed (one man spanish fly)

As for individual finishers...

Blood Rush (Reverse Gory Guerrero Special Knee-Drop Pancake): Lift the opponent for a Kudo Driver/Vertebreaker (Reverse Gory Guerrero Special), and then push them backwards while falling to your knees. The opponent lands with a front bump, a la the Pedigree, while you land on your knees.

USERS: I've only seen Jerry Lynn do this move, but I actually had the idea for it before I saw Lynn do it.

 

Sunset Driver (Side Piledriver): Lift the opponent into an over-the-shoulder powerbomb position (as if to go for an Awesome Bomb), and then slide them down so that they are vertical. Hold onto their head with the same arm of the side they are on (right arm if over right shoulder, etc.), and hold their body against your shoulder with your other arm. Fall down to the side at an angle between sitting and falling backwards, driving the opponent head-first into the mat (inverted Emerald Fusion).

USERS: AJ Styles does something similar, where he has the opponent in an over-the-shoulder position, and then drops them into a DDT from there.
